Ingredients for Pioneer Woman Banana Cake With Cream Cheese Frosting Recipe

Here’s what you’ll need to make this delicious Pioneer Woman Banana Cake With Cream Cheese Frosting Recipe:

1/2 cup (1 stick) butter – Softened to room temperature for perfect creaming with sugar.

1½ cups granulated sugar – Adds sweetness and contributes to the cake’s moisture.

2 large eggs – Essential for binding and adding richness to the cake.

1 cup sour cream – Helps achieve a tender crumb and adds a subtle tang.

1 teaspoon vanilla extract – Enhances all the flavors and adds a hint of warmth.

2 cups all-purpose flour – The base of our cake, providing structure and stability.

1 teaspoon baking soda – A leavening agent that gives the cake its light texture.

1/4 teaspoon salt – Balances sweetness and enhances the overall flavor.

1 cup mashed bananas (about 3 bananas) – The star of the show, infusing natural sweetness and moisture.

1 bar (8 oz) cream cheese – The creamy base for the frosting, providing that delightful tang.

3 cups powdered sugar – Adds sweetness and the perfect texture to the frosting.

2 tablespoons heavy whipping cream – Helps achieve the ideal frosting consistency.

How to Make Pioneer Woman Banana Cake With Cream Cheese Frosting Recipe

Follow these simple steps to prepare this delicious Pioneer Woman Banana Cake With Cream Cheese Frosting Recipe:

Step 1: Preheat and Prepare
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grab your trusty 9×13 baking dish and generously spray it with cooking spray, ensuring scrummy leftovers won’t stick to the sides.

Step 2: Cream Butter and Sugar
In a large mixing bowl, cream together the softened butter and granulated sugar until the mixture is light and fluffy. This usually takes about 4-5 minutes, so don’t rush; this step is crucial for a tender cake!

Step 3: Incorporate Eggs and Sour Cream
Add the eggs, sour cream, and vanilla extract into the creamed mixture, blending well until everything is combined and creamy. Take a moment to inhale the delicious aroma wafting from your bowl — trust me, it only gets better from here.

Step 4: Mix Dry Ingredients
In another bowl, whisk together the flour, baking soda, and salt. Then, gradually add this dry mixture to your wet ingredients, mixing on low speed just until everything is combined — no one wants overworked cake batter!

Step 5: Add Bananas
Gently fold in the mashed bananas until evenly distributed. The batter will smell divine, and you may find yourself “testing” it with a spoon!

Step 6: Bake and Cool
Pour the batter into your prepared dish, smoothing it out evenly. Bake in the oven for 25-35 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ean or with just a few moist crumbs attached. Once baked, allow the cake to cool completely on a wire rack before frosting using the next steps.

Step 7: Prepare the Cream Cheese Frosting
In a separate bowl, beat together the softened cream cheese and the remaining stick of softened butter until fully combined and fluffy. Then mix in the vanilla extract, powdered sugar, and heavy cream. Start on low speed to avoid a powdered sugar explosion, then increase the speed until you have a thick, creamy frosting. Adjust the consistency by adding more powdered sugar or milk as needed.

Step 8: Frost and Serve
Once the cake is cooled, cut it into squares and generously spread the cream cheese frosting over the top. For an extra touch, garnish each piece with banana slices and a sprinkle of chopped walnuts. Serve at your next gathering, and watch it disappear faster than you can say “banana cake.”

Add Your Touch to Pioneer Woman Banana Cake With Cream Cheese Frosting Recipe

Feel free to customize this banana cake by adding chocolate chips, nuts, or a sprinkle of cinnamon for a warm spice. You can also swap sour cream for Greek yogurt for a healthier twist or use dairy-free butter for a vegan version.

Storing & Reheating Pioneer Woman Banana Cake With Cream Cheese Frosting Recipe

To store, wrap the cake tightly in plastic wrap and keep it in the refrigerator for up to a week. When ready to enjoy, simply bring it to room temperature or lightly microwave for a few seconds to regain its delectable softness.

Delicious Pioneer Woman Banana Cake With Cream Cheese Frosting Recipe

This Delicious Pioneer Woman Banana Cake With Cream Cheese Frosting Recipe is a moist delight, ideal for gatherings and loved by all.
Prep Time 20 minutes
Cook Time 30 minutes
Cooling Time 2 hours
Total Time 2 hours 45 minutes
Servings: 18 slices
Course: Dessert Recipes
Cuisine: American
Calories: 350

Ingredients
  

Butter and Cream Cheese
  • 1 stick butter softened
  • 1 bar cream cheese 8 oz
Sugars
  • 1.5 cups granulated sugar
  • 3 cups powdered sugar
Wet Ingredients
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1 cup sour cream
  • 2 tablespoons heavy whipping cream
  • 2 teaspoons vanilla extract
Dry Ingredients
  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da
  • 0.25 teaspoon salt
Bananas
  • 1 cup mashed bananas about 3 bananas

Equipment

  • 9x13 baking dish
  • mixing bowls
  • Electric mixer

Method
 

Preparation
  1. Heat oven to 350°F. Prepare a 9x13 baking dish and spray with cooking spray. Set aside.
  2. In a large bowl, cream butter and granulated sugar together until light and fluffy.
  3. Add eggs, sour cream, and vanilla. Blend together until combined and creamy.
  4. Add flour, baking soda, and salt. Blend on low speed just until combined.
  5. Add mashed bananas and gently stir together. Dump batter into the baking dish and spread out evenly.
  6. Cook for 25-35 minutes or until a toothpick inserted in the middle comes out with moist crumbs or nothing at all.
  7. Let cake cool completely before frosting.
Frosting
  1. In a large bowl, beat butter and cream cheese together until combined.
  2. Add in vanilla extract, powdered sugar, and heavy cream. Beat together until frosting forms.
  3. Add more powdered sugar and/or milk until desired frosting consistency is reached.
  4. Cut into squares and garnish each piece with banana slices and chopped walnuts.

Nutrition

Serving: 1sliceCalories: 350kcalCarbohydrates: 52gProtein: 5gFat: 15gSodium: 294mgFiber: 1gSugar: 39g
